  2. Joint responsibility for the processing of personal data

The purposes and means of processing personal data when you visit our Facebook page http://www.facebook.com/pages/JOI-Design/353046843461 (“Facebook page”) are jointly provided by JOI-Design Innenarchitekten AD joehnk + partner mbB , Bebelallee 141, 22297, Germany (“JOI-Design Interior Architects AD joehnk + partner mbB”) and Facebook Ireland Ltd. (“Facebook”) as defined within the meaning of Art. 26 EU General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). This results from the fact that JOI-Design Innenarchitekten AD joehnk + partner mbB, as the operator of the Facebook page, gives Facebook the opportunity to set up such a page on the computer or any other device of the person visiting the Facebook page (“Visitors “) to place cookies regardless of whether the visitor has a Facebook account.

As part of the joint controllership, Facebook assumes primary responsibility according to the GDPR for the processing of Insights data and fulfills all obligations from the GDPR with regard to the processing of Insights data (including Articles 12 and 13 GDPR, Articles 15 to 22 GDPR and Articles 32 to 34 GDPR). In addition, Facebook provides the essentials of this page insights supplement to the data subjects (you can find the corresponding “Page Insights Controller Addendum” here: https://www.facebook.com/legal/terms/page_controller_addendum).

Below you will find a description of how the personal data is handled by JOI-Design Interior Architects A D joehnk + partner mbB and Facebook when visiting the Facebook page. However, since JOI-Design Innenarchitekten AD joehnk + partner mbB generally or to a large extent has no influence on the data collected by Facebook and their processing by Facebook, we are currently unable to conclusively inform on the purpose and scope of the processing of your data by Facebook. However, we will observe further developments in this regard and adjust this data protection declaration accordingly if necessary.

2. Description and scope of data processing

As the operator of the Facebook page, JOI-Design Innenarchitekten A D joehnk + partner mbB can use the Facebook Page Insights function, which Facebook provides to us free of charge as an essential part of the user relationship, to receive anonymized statistical data regarding the visitors to our Facebook page. This data is collected by using the cookies set by Facebook, each of which contains a unique user code and which Facebook stores on the end device of the visitor. The user code, which can be linked to the registration data of such users who are registered with Facebook, is collected and processed when the Facebook page is accessed.

In particular, the Facebook fan page operator can receive demographic data about his target group – and thus information on the processing of this data – i.e. among other things trends in the areas of age, gender, relationship status and professional situation, information about the lifestyle and interests of his target group and information about purchases and online buying behavior of visitors to his page, the categories of goods or services that interest them most, as well as geographic data that inform him about where special promotions or events are to be organized and generally enable him to make his information offer as targeted as possible.

Although the visitor statistics created by Facebook are only transmitted in anonymous form to JOI-Design Innenarchitekten AD joehnk + partner mbB as the operator of the Facebook page, the creation of these statistics is based on the previous survey – by those set by Facebook on the visitor’s device cookies – and the processing of the personal data of these visitors for these statistical purposes. For more information about Facebook Page Insights, please visit:

https://www.facebook.com/legal/terms/information_about_page_insights_data

https://de-de.facebook.com/help/pages/insights

This also provides data on the Facebook groups linked to our Facebook page. The constant development of Facebook changes the availability and preparation of the data, so that for further details we refer to the Facebook data protection notices corresponding to the previous paragraph and below under “PROCESSING PERSONAL DATA BY FACEBOOK”.

We use this data, which is available in aggregate form, to make our posts and activities on our Facebook page more attractive to users. So we use e.g. the distributions by age and gender for an adapted address and the preferred visiting times of the users for a time-optimized planning of our contributions. Information about the type of end device used by visitors helps us to adapt the articles visually and creatively. When accessing a Facebook page, the IP address assigned to your device is transmitted to Facebook. According to Facebook, this IP address is anonymized (for “German” IP addresses) and deleted after 90 days. Facebook also stores information about the end devices of its users (in particular as part of the “registration notification” function); Facebook may be able to assign IP addresses to individual users.

If you want to avoid this, you should log out of Facebook or deactivate the “stay logged in” function, delete the cookies on your device and close and restart your browser. In this way, Facebook information, through which you can be identified immediately, is deleted. This allows you to use our Facebook page without revealing your Facebook ID. If you access the interactive functions of the site (like, comment, share, messages, etc.), a Facebook login screen appears. After you have logged in, Facebook will again recognize you as a specific user.
